Discover Nigeria

Nigeria is often referred to as the 'Giant of Africa,' being the continent's most populous nation and a powerhouse of culture, music, and commerce. It is a land of extreme diversity, from the tropical rainforests of the south to the savannahs of the north, and home to the world-famous Nollywood film industry.

Safety & Scams
Exercise a high degree of caution; avoid all travel to the north-east due to terrorism (Boko Haram); kidnapping and armed robbery are significant risks in many parts of the country including Lagos and Abuja; always use private transport arranged by reputable companies; avoid walking alone at night; monitor local media constantly; healthcare is adequate in private clinics in major cities but limited elsewhere; malaria prophylaxis is mandatory.
Getting Around
Domestic flights (Air Peace, Dana Air) are the safest way to travel between major cities; 'Danfo' buses (yellow minivans) are the iconic but chaotic mode of transport in Lagos; ride-hailing apps like Uber and Bolt are popular and safer for foreigners; rail services are improving, notably the Lagos-Ibadan and Abuja-Kaduna lines.
Cultural Etiquette
Respect for elders is paramount; greetings should be enthusiastic; hospitality is a source of pride; punctuality can be flexible (African time); ask permission before taking photos; remember that Nigerians are very expressive and loud conversations are normal.
Internet & Connectivity
Digital infrastructure is booming; 4G/5G is widely available in cities like Lagos and Abuja via MTN, Airtel, and Glo; fiber internet is increasing in business districts; some outages can occur due to power instability.
